Sometimes you don't have to spend a fortune



The other day I was in my favourite paper crafts shop and I came across two of the nicest papers I have seen in a long time. I knew I had to get them as they had parasals and lanterns, two things I absolutely love. I am challenging myself to make cards that don't cost much and I am happy to say that the cards that I made out of this paper have cost me about $1.50 or even less, all I have done is used the paper as the main embellishment, I have cut out the lantern's and parasals and paper pieced them using self adhesive dimensional foam. I have purchased quite a lot of this paper and look forward to using them in future creations.

This is another simple card that I have used making a new KennyK retro image. For this card I printed the image of the lady and the sentiment directly onto the cardstock. I cut the cardstock so that a part of her shoe, dress and hair is slightly off the page, I feel this adds some movement and dimension to the card. When I paper pieced the dress I stuck it on the cardstock so that the dress was slightly lifted, added the ribbon and bling to finish off. I am really happy with the way this card has turned out and it's another card that's quick and easy card to make, simple cards are pretty much all I can manage at the moment.
